The President,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o, on Monday, 21st June 2021, has promised the people of Bawku a guinea fowl processing factory under government’s 1-District-1-Factory initiative.

“In the same way under the 1-District-1-Factory policy, very soon we are going to establish a guinea fowl processing factory here in Bawku. I am so happy to hear the commitment you have made to stop the smuggling of fertilizer from the area. It is a very important commitment, and I applaud you very much for it,” he added.

In Ghana, the past few years have seen an increase in support for guinea fowl production through developmental projects such as Smallholder Agricultural Development Project (SADEP), Smallholder Rehabilitation Development Programme (SRDP) and part two of the WAAPP project.

Together these initiatives have resulted in a growth in capacity and financing. One outcome has been the “introduction of 1,000 capacity incubators and technical support” to farmers, which, according to Augustine Danquah, the monitoring and evaluation specialist for WAAPP, resulted in “farm expansion through higher bird population, and increased incomes and livelihoods” for Ghanaian guinea fowl producers.
